To-Do List on your Dominican Republic Vacations

Drawing out an itinerary for your Dominican Republic vacations is just as fun as making the travel itself. Being the Caribbeans largest tourism destination, the Dominican Republic hosts year-long sports as well as leisure activities giving every traveler a holiday experience worth remembering. La Romana, for one, is well-known to tourists who love to engage in horseback riding and play sports like golf and tennis. For those who fancy a travel back in time, the Altos de Chavon offers an ambience reminiscent of an early Medieval European setting, complete with cobble-covered alleyways lined with lanterns, Mediterranean bars, quaint shops, and art galleries. The countrys capital, Santo Domingo, should not be missed, as it is the venue for some of the World Heritage sites oldest cathedral, university, and castle. Punta Cana and Puerto Plata are posh resorts that are sure to excite and thrill beach lovers with its mile-long stretch of white sandy shores and pristine waters.
